188B/888B investment immigration

188B investor temporary residence visa (lnvestor Stream), also known as 188B investment immigration visa, is one of the three major categories of Australian business immigration 188 visa. The 188B visa is a five-year temporary residence visa established for professionals who specialize in various investment activities such as stocks, futures, funds, and foreign exchange. This visa does not require the applicant to have a business, but it requires the applicant to have A certain amount of investment experience and a certain amount of income has been obtained from it. After the visa is approved, the applicant must maintain 2.5 million Australian dollars invested in a compliant fund company for 3 years (the investment amount is 1.5 million before July 1, 2021, invested in government state bonds, The period is 4 years) and you can transfer to the 888B permanent residence visa after meeting certain residence conditions. Before submitting the 188B investment immigration visa, the applicant needs to submit an EOl first, and must first obtain a guarantee from the Australian state or territory government.

188B visa general requirements

● Need to get EOl invitation (be invited to apply);
● be guaranteed by the state government;
● Be younger than 55 years old (unless exempted by the state government);
● The score reaches 65 points (click to view the 188A investment immigration self-test form);
● Successful business or investment history.

188B visa application conditions

● If the main applicant is under 55 years old or is exempted from age by the state government, the accompanying children must not exceed 23 years old when the visa is approved.
● The EOI score of the business selection system is no less than 65 points
● At least 3 years of successful direct investment or management experience in one or more businesses
● In the two financial years before being invited, the applicant (or together with the spouse) has a total family net worth of no less than 2.5 million Australian dollars.
● Invested AUD 2.5 million in Australia for a period of 3 years before the visa application was approved (the investment amount is AUD 1.5 million before July 1, 2021, and the investment period is 4 years).
● Applicants and their spouses must meet the following investment requirements:
Hold at least 10% of the shares in a qualifying business in at least one of the five financial years before being invited
Participated in the management of investments worth at least AUD 2.5 million in at least 1 of the 5 financial years preceding the invitation:
● Not involved in illegal activities.
● Requirements for investing in Australia
Invest A$2.5 million over three years in the following funds:
1. Venture capital and growth private equity funds of at least A$500,000 invested in start-ups and small private enterprises
2. At least AUD750,000 of approved managed funds invested in emerging companies listed on the ASX
3. A flat investment of at least A$1.25 million in managed funds that may invest in a range of assets (including ASX-listed companies, Australian corporate bonds or notes, annuities and commercial real estate)

188B visa application fee

● Main Applicant: AU $6,085.00
Sub-applicant over 18 years old: AU S 3,045.00
Deputy caller under 18 years old: AU $1,520.00

● Language training fee:
1. If the main applicant does not have an IELTS score report with a total score of 4.5, pay a language fee of AU$ 9,795.00
2. Spouse or accompanying children aged 18 or over, if the IELTS score does not reach 4.5, the language learning fee is AU $ 4,890.00/person. (Note: The above fees are subject to the final fees charged by the Australian immigration department)
